Answer to Question 1

ANSWER: 1. Numbers and Operations includes counting, one-to-one correspondence, classifying, sorting, part-whole relationships, comparison, recognizing and writing numerals, and place value.
2. Patterns, Functions, and Algebra includes use of symbols and order.
3. Geometry and Spatial Sense includes analyzing, exploring and investigating shapes and structures.
4. Measurement includes recognizing and comparing attributes of length, volume, weight, and time.
5. Data Analysis and Probability includes collecting and organizing data about individuals and the environment.
6. Problem Solving includes reasoning, communication, connections, and representation.

Did you know?

Hypertension is a silent killer because it is deadly and has no significant early symptoms. The danger from hypertension is the extra load on the heart, which can lead to hypertensive heart disease and kidney damage. This occurs without any major symptoms until the high blood pressure becomes extreme. Regular blood pressure checks are an important method of catching hypertension before it can kill you.

Did you know?

The term bacteria was devised in the 19th century by German biologist Ferdinand Cohn. He based it on the Greek word "bakterion" meaning a small rod or staff. Cohn is considered to be the father of modern bacteriology.
